Berikut ialah ringkasan beberapa teg templat yang sering dilupakan oleh ruangan tutorial WordPress Saya harap ia dapat membantu rakan yang memerlukan.
Sejak WordPress wujud, ia telah menyediakan kami dengan sejumlah besar teg templat. Teg templat ini ialah fungsi PHP yang boleh digunakan untuk mengeluarkan dan mendapatkan semula sekeping data. Jika anda telah membangunkan tema WordPress, anda sepatutnya sudah biasa dengan beberapa teg templat, seperti teg the_title yang digunakan untuk memaparkan tajuk artikel, teg the_author yang digunakan untuk memaparkan nama pengarang artikel, dsb.
WordPress sentiasa berkembang selama bertahun-tahun, dan setiap keluaran baharu membawakan kami beberapa teg templat baharu. Oleh itu, amat sukar bagi sesiapa sahaja untuk menjejaki semua teg templat pada setiap masa. Dalam artikel ini, kami meringkaskan beberapa teg templat yang sering dilupakan.
P mesti menggunakan huruf besar
Mengikut garis panduan dan piawaiannya, huruf "P" dalam WordPress mesti menggunakan huruf besar.
Pada tahun 2009, pengasas WordPress Matt Mullenweg melancarkan fungsi capital_p_dangit() khas untuk membantu orang mengeja nama dengan betul.
// Anda boleh menggunakan fungsi ini terus
$footer_text = get_theme_mod( "footer_text", "" ); $footer_text = captial_p_dangit( $footer_text ); // Any WordPress text is turned with capital P. // 或是在WordPress Filter中使用 add_filter( "the_excerpt", function( $text ) { return captial_p_dangit( $text ); } );
Logo Tersuai
Dalam versi 4.5, WordPress melancarkan Fungsi memuat naik logo sebagai tema dalam Penyesuai. Ciri baharu ini memerlukan sokongan tema: dengan menambahkan add_theme_support( 'site-logo' ), logo akan muncul dalam Penyesuai.
Selepas ciri ini muncul, kami boleh menggunakan beberapa teg templat baharu, yang boleh mengendalikan output imej logo pada tema: has_custom_logo(), get_custom_logo(), dan the_custom_logo().
// 1. 输出包括图像logo和回到主页的连接 the_custom_logo(); // 2. 获得自定义logo output "string" $logo = get_custom_logo(); // 3. 条件 if ( has_custom_logo() ) { $logo = get_custom_logo(); } // 4. 使用'get_custom_logo'将logo打包在div中 add_filter( "get_custom_logo", function( $html ) { return ''. $html .''; } );
URL lakaran kenit
WordPress mempunyai keupayaan untuk menambah lakaran kecil atau imej yang ditampilkan untuk masa yang lama. Teg templat The_post_thumbnail() boleh memaparkan kedua-dua teg imej dan nilainya. Tetapi bagaimana jika anda ingin menetapkan lakaran kecil sebagai latar belakang menggunakan CSS? Anda boleh menggunakan tag ini:
get_the_post_thumbnail_url().
Contoh:
'ol', 'short_ping' => true, 'avatar_size' => 42, ) ); ?>
Atas ialah kandungan terperinci Apakah teg templat WordPress yang terlupa?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!